AT&T is taking significant strides to ensure uninterrupted service for its vast customer base, which includes 145 million wireless and 16 million broadband users. In an industry where even a brief outage can have substantial financial repercussions, the telecommunications giant has developed an innovative AI-driven system designed to minimize disruptions and enhance service reliability. The need for such a system became evident after a major outage in February 2024, which resulted in over 92 million blocked voice calls and more than 25,000 failed 911 calls, as reported by the US Federal Communications Commission. With other telecom providers like Verizon and T-Mobile also facing similar challenges in recent years, AT&T recognized the importance of improving their response to outages. "We have to know of any network interruptions immediately and solve them, ideally before any customer feels it," stated Andy Markus, AT&T's chief data and AI officer. Beginning in 2017, AT&T initiated the development of its end-to-end incident management system (EEIM), integrating advanced technologies from companies such as MongoDB and Snowflake. Initially based on traditional machine learning, the system has progressively incorporated generative and agentic AI capabilities, significantly enhancing its operational efficiency. This advanced tool is now capable of diagnosing issues, suggesting remote fixes, or dispatching technicians when necessary, while also keeping customers informed about outages. Telecommunications outages can arise from various factors, including severe weather, technical malfunctions, and even cyberattacks. Recognizing the pressure on customer service centers during such events, AT&T aimed to create a system that responds more effectively to these challenges. By assembling a cross-functional team, the company gathered insights from IT, data, and AI departments, as well as field technicians who manage network repairs. The EEIM processes an immense volume of data—around 10 petabytes, which equates to approximately 5,000 billion pages of text. This extensive data includes network logs and incident reports, all meticulously organized to facilitate problem detection and prediction. MongoDB’s elastic database platform plays a pivotal role, allowing AT&T to scale its data management capabilities seamlessly. Additionally, Microsoft Azure, Databricks, and Snowflake are integral to the EEIM's functionality. The EEIM was first operational for broadband fiber in early 2018, with subsequent expansions to cover DSL services. A complementary application, Atlas, was launched in June 2018 to assist field technicians by utilizing AI to diagnose outages and propose solutions. Since Andy Markus joined the company in July 2020, AT&T has witnessed a significant increase in AI adoption, with around 100,000 employees now using these advanced tools. By the first quarter of 2021, AT&T introduced a proactive customer notification system, further easing customer frustrations during outages. The incorporation of generative AI features in early 2022 allowed the EEIM to analyze historical data to identify potential outage causes more effectively. Recent enhancements include the addition of AI agents capable of interacting with customers to gather details about outages and assist technicians in the field. In total, the AI-empowered EEIM has prevented 3.1 million unnecessary technician visits and has remarkably reduced customer downtime by over 12 million hours in the past year, demonstrating AT&T’s commitment to leveraging technology for improved service delivery.
